For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public high school serving 40 students in Savage, MT.
Savage, MT public high school have an average math proficiency score of 50% (versus the Montana public high school average of 32%).
Minority enrollment is 18% of the student body (majority American Indian), which is less than the Montana public high school average of 23% (majority American Indian).
